About the Book

This book is organized into three sections intended to help boards work through the process of instituting BoardSteps.

Section 1 consists of the Introduction, which explains the rationale for the book, discusses the importance of board governance and sketches the basics of the framework.

Section 2, Practicing BoardSteps, focuses on the actual process of setting up a governance structure through identification and pursuit of desired results, essential relationships, and existing and potential resources.

The process is covered at two distinct levels in six steps:

Section 3, Standards, Worksheets, and References, addresses the development of standards, presents worksheets that supplement Section Two, and notes references. The BoardSteps job description is located at the end of this section.

By consulting the material and worksheets in all three sections of this book, a board can assemble the building blocks of a governance system appropriate to its particular organization.
